Method: people.getBatchGet

با تعیین لیستی از نام منابع درخواستی، اطلاعاتی در مورد لیستی از افراد خاص ارائه می دهد. people/me برای نشان دادن کاربر تایید شده استفاده کنید.

اگر «personFields» مشخص نشده باشد، درخواست یک خطای 400 برمی‌گرداند.

درخواست HTTP

GET https://people.googleapis.com/v1/people:batchGet

URL از دستور GRPC Transcoding استفاده می کند.

پارامترهای پرس و جو

پارامترها
resourceNames[]

string

مورد نیاز. نام منابع افراد برای ارائه اطلاعات در مورد. قابل تکرار است پارامتر پرس و جو URL باید باشد

resourceNames=<name1>&resourceNames=<name2>&...

  • برای دریافت اطلاعات در مورد کاربر احراز هویت شده، people/me را مشخص کنید.
  • برای دریافت اطلاعات درباره حساب Google، people/{account_id} را مشخص کنید.
  • برای دریافت اطلاعات در مورد یک مخاطب، نام منبعی را مشخص کنید که مخاطب را به عنوان بازگردانده شده توسط people.connections.list مشخص می کند.

حداکثر 200 نام منبع وجود دارد.

requestMask
(deprecated)

object ( RequestMask )

منسوخ شده (لطفا به جای آن از personFields استفاده کنید)

ماسکی برای محدود کردن نتایج به زیر مجموعه ای از فیلدهای شخص.

personFields

string ( FieldMask format)

مورد نیاز. یک فیلد ماسک برای محدود کردن اینکه کدام فیلد برای هر فرد بازگردانده می شود. چندین فیلد را می توان با جدا کردن آنها با کاما مشخص کرد. مقادیر معتبر عبارتند از:

  • آدرس ها
  • محدوده سنی
  • بیوگرافی ها
  • تولدها
  • calendarUrls
  • کلاینت دیتا
  • جلدعکس ها
  • آدرس های ایمیل
  • رویدادها
  • شناسه های خارجی
  • جنسیت ها
  • imClients
  • منافع
  • مناطق
  • مکان ها
  • عضویت ها
  • ابرداده
  • کلمات کلیدی اشتباه
  • نام ها
  • نام مستعار
  • مشاغل
  • سازمان ها
  • شماره تلفن
  • عکس ها
  • روابط
  • آدرس های sip
  • مهارت ها
  • آدرس های اینترنتی
  • userDefined
sources[]

enum ( ReadSourceType )

اختیاری. ماسکی از نوع منبع برای بازگشت. در صورت تنظیم نشدن، پیش‌فرض READ_SOURCE_TYPE_CONTACT و READ_SOURCE_TYPE_PROFILE است.

درخواست بدن

بدنه درخواست باید خالی باشد.

بدن پاسخگو

پاسخ به درخواست دریافت لیستی از افراد بر اساس نام منبع.

در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:

نمایندگی JSON
{
  "responses": [
    {
      object (PersonResponse)
    }
  ]
}
فیلدها
responses[]

object ( PersonResponse )

پاسخ برای هر نام منبع درخواستی.

محدوده مجوز

برای دسترسی به داده های عمومی نیازی به مجوز نیست. برای داده های خصوصی، یکی از حوزه های OAuth زیر مورد نیاز است:

  • https://www.googleapis.com/auth/contacts
  • https://www.googleapis.com/auth/contacts.readonly
  • https://www.googleapis.com/auth/contacts.other.readonly
  • https://www.googleapis.com/auth/directory.readonly
  • https://www.googleapis.com/auth/profile.agerange.read
  • https://www.googleapis.com/auth/profile.emails.read
  • https://www.googleapis.com/auth/profile.language.read
  • https://www.googleapis.com/auth/user.addresses.read
  • https://www.googleapis.com/auth/user.birthday.read
  • https://www.googleapis.com/auth/user.emails.read
  • https://www.googleapis.com/auth/user.gender.read
  • https://www.googleapis.com/auth/user.organization.read
  • https://www.googleapis.com/auth/user.phonenumbers.read
  • https://www.googleapis.com/auth/userinfo.email
  • https://www.googleapis.com/auth/userinfo.profile
  • https://www.googleapis.com/auth/profile.language.read

بر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.

،

با تعیین لیستی از نام منابع درخواستی، اطلاعاتی در مورد لیستی از افراد خاص ارائه می دهد. people/me برای نشان دادن کاربر تایید شده استفاده کنید.

اگر «personFields» مشخص نشده باشد، درخواست یک خطای 400 برمی‌گرداند.

درخواست HTTP

GET https://people.googleapis.com/v1/people:batchGet

URL از دستور GRPC Transcoding استفاده می کند.

پارامترهای پرس و جو

پارامترها
resourceNames[]

string

مورد نیاز. نام منابع افراد برای ارائه اطلاعات در مورد. قابل تکرار است پارامتر پرس و جو URL باید باشد

resourceNames=<name1>&resourceNames=<name2>&...

  • برای دریافت اطلاعات در مورد کاربر احراز هویت شده، people/me را مشخص کنید.
  • برای دریافت اطلاعات درباره حساب Google، people/{account_id} را مشخص کنید.
  • برای دریافت اطلاعات در مورد یک مخاطب، نام منبعی را مشخص کنید که مخاطب را به عنوان بازگردانده شده توسط people.connections.list مشخص می کند.

حداکثر 200 نام منبع وجود دارد.

requestMask
(deprecated)

object ( RequestMask )

منسوخ شده (لطفا به جای آن از personFields استفاده کنید)

ماسکی برای محدود کردن نتایج به زیر مجموعه ای از فیلدهای شخص.

personFields

string ( FieldMask format)

مورد نیاز. یک فیلد ماسک برای محدود کردن اینکه کدام فیلد برای هر فرد بازگردانده می شود. چندین فیلد را می توان با جدا کردن آنها با کاما مشخص کرد. مقادیر معتبر عبارتند از:

  • آدرس ها
  • محدوده سنی
  • بیوگرافی ها
  • تولدها
  • calendarUrls
  • کلاینت دیتا
  • جلدعکس ها
  • آدرس های ایمیل
  • رویدادها
  • شناسه های خارجی
  • جنسیت ها
  • imClients
  • منافع
  • مناطق
  • مکان ها
  • عضویت ها
  • ابرداده
  • کلمات کلیدی اشتباه
  • نام ها
  • نام مستعار
  • مشاغل
  • سازمان ها
  • شماره تلفن
  • عکس ها
  • روابط
  • آدرس های sip
  • مهارت ها
  • آدرس های اینترنتی
  • userDefined
sources[]

enum ( ReadSourceType )

اختیاری. ماسکی از نوع منبع برای بازگشت. در صورت تنظیم نشدن، پیش‌فرض READ_SOURCE_TYPE_CONTACT و READ_SOURCE_TYPE_PROFILE است.

درخواست بدن

بدنه درخواست باید خالی باشد.

بدن پاسخگو

پاسخ به درخواست دریافت لیستی از افراد بر اساس نام منبع.

در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:

نمایندگی JSON
{
  "responses": [
    {
      object (PersonResponse)
    }
  ]
}
فیلدها
responses[]

object ( PersonResponse )

پاسخ برای هر نام منبع درخواستی.

محدوده مجوز

برای دسترسی به داده های عمومی نیازی به مجوز نیست. برای داده های خصوصی، یکی از حوزه های OAuth زیر مورد نیاز است:

  • https://www.googleapis.com/auth/contacts
  • https://www.googleapis.com/auth/contacts.readonly
  • https://www.googleapis.com/auth/contacts.other.readonly
  • https://www.googleapis.com/auth/directory.readonly
  • https://www.googleapis.com/auth/profile.agerange.read
  • https://www.googleapis.com/auth/profile.emails.read
  • https://www.googleapis.com/auth/profile.language.read
  • https://www.googleapis.com/auth/user.addresses.read
  • https://www.googleapis.com/auth/user.birthday.read
  • https://www.googleapis.com/auth/user.emails.read
  • https://www.googleapis.com/auth/user.gender.read
  • https://www.googleapis.com/auth/user.organization.read
  • https://www.googleapis.com/auth/user.phonenumbers.read
  • https://www.googleapis.com/auth/userinfo.email
  • https://www.googleapis.com/auth/userinfo.profile
  • https://www.googleapis.com/auth/profile.language.read

بر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.

،

با تعیین لیستی از نام منابع درخواستی، اطلاعاتی در مورد لیستی از افراد خاص ارائه می دهد. people/me برای نشان دادن کاربر تایید شده استفاده کنید.

اگر «personFields» مشخص نشده باشد، درخواست یک خطای 400 برمی‌گرداند.

درخواست HTTP

GET https://people.googleapis.com/v1/people:batchGet

URL از دستور GRPC Transcoding استفاده می کند.

پارامترهای پرس و جو

پارامترها
resourceNames[]

string

مورد نیاز. نام منابع افراد برای ارائه اطلاعات در مورد. قابل تکرار است پارامتر پرس و جو URL باید باشد

resourceNames=<name1>&resourceNames=<name2>&...

  • برای دریافت اطلاعات در مورد کاربر احراز هویت شده، people/me را مشخص کنید.
  • برای دریافت اطلاعات درباره حساب Google، people/{account_id} را مشخص کنید.
  • برای دریافت اطلاعات در مورد یک مخاطب، نام منبعی را مشخص کنید که مخاطب را به عنوان بازگردانده شده توسط people.connections.list مشخص می کند.

حداکثر 200 نام منبع وجود دارد.

requestMask
(deprecated)

object ( RequestMask )

منسوخ شده (لطفا به جای آن از personFields استفاده کنید)

ماسکی برای محدود کردن نتایج به زیر مجموعه ای از فیلدهای شخص.

personFields

string ( FieldMask format)

مورد نیاز. یک فیلد ماسک برای محدود کردن اینکه کدام فیلد برای هر فرد بازگردانده می شود. چندین فیلد را می توان با جدا کردن آنها با کاما مشخص کرد. مقادیر معتبر عبارتند از:

  • آدرس ها
  • محدوده سنی
  • بیوگرافی ها
  • تولدها
  • calendarUrls
  • کلاینت دیتا
  • جلدعکس ها
  • آدرس های ایمیل
  • رویدادها
  • شناسه های خارجی
  • جنسیت ها
  • imClients
  • منافع
  • مناطق
  • مکان ها
  • عضویت ها
  • ابرداده
  • کلمات کلیدی اشتباه
  • نام ها
  • نام مستعار
  • مشاغل
  • سازمان ها
  • شماره تلفن
  • عکس ها
  • روابط
  • آدرس های sip
  • مهارت ها
  • آدرس های اینترنتی
  • userDefined
sources[]

enum ( ReadSourceType )

اختیاری. ماسکی از نوع منبع برای بازگشت. در صورت تنظیم نشدن، پیش‌فرض READ_SOURCE_TYPE_CONTACT و READ_SOURCE_TYPE_PROFILE است.

درخواست بدن

بدنه درخواست باید خالی باشد.

بدن پاسخگو

پاسخ به درخواست دریافت لیستی از افراد بر اساس نام منبع.

در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:

نمایندگی JSON
{
  "responses": [
    {
      object (PersonResponse)
    }
  ]
}
فیلدها
responses[]

object ( PersonResponse )

پاسخ برای هر نام منبع درخواستی.

محدوده مجوز

برای دسترسی به داده های عمومی نیازی به مجوز نیست. برای داده های خصوصی، یکی از حوزه های OAuth زیر مورد نیاز است:

  • https://www.googleapis.com/auth/contacts
  • https://www.googleapis.com/auth/contacts.readonly
  • https://www.googleapis.com/auth/contacts.other.readonly
  • https://www.googleapis.com/auth/directory.readonly
  • https://www.googleapis.com/auth/profile.agerange.read
  • https://www.googleapis.com/auth/profile.emails.read
  • https://www.googleapis.com/auth/profile.language.read
  • https://www.googleapis.com/auth/user.addresses.read
  • https://www.googleapis.com/auth/user.birthday.read
  • https://www.googleapis.com/auth/user.emails.read
  • https://www.googleapis.com/auth/user.gender.read
  • https://www.googleapis.com/auth/user.organization.read
  • https://www.googleapis.com/auth/user.phonenumbers.read
  • https://www.googleapis.com/auth/userinfo.email
  • https://www.googleapis.com/auth/userinfo.profile
  • https://www.googleapis.com/auth/profile.language.read

بر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.

،

با تعیین لیستی از نام منابع درخواستی، اطلاعاتی در مورد لیستی از افراد خاص ارائه می دهد. people/me برای نشان دادن کاربر تایید شده استفاده کنید.

اگر «personFields» مشخص نشده باشد، درخواست یک خطای 400 برمی‌گرداند.

درخواست HTTP

GET https://people.googleapis.com/v1/people:batchGet

URL از دستور GRPC Transcoding استفاده می کند.

پارامترهای پرس و جو

پارامترها
resourceNames[]

string

مورد نیاز. نام منابع افراد برای ارائه اطلاعات در مورد. قابل تکرار است پارامتر پرس و جو URL باید باشد

resourceNames=<name1>&resourceNames=<name2>&...

  • برای دریافت اطلاعات در مورد کاربر احراز هویت شده، people/me را مشخص کنید.
  • برای دریافت اطلاعات درباره حساب Google، people/{account_id} را مشخص کنید.
  • برای دریافت اطلاعات در مورد یک مخاطب، نام منبعی را مشخص کنید که مخاطب را به عنوان بازگردانده شده توسط people.connections.list مشخص می کند.

حداکثر 200 نام منبع وجود دارد.

requestMask
(deprecated)

object ( RequestMask )

منسوخ شده (لطفا به جای آن از personFields استفاده کنید)

ماسکی برای محدود کردن نتایج به زیر مجموعه ای از فیلدهای شخص.

personFields

string ( FieldMask format)

مورد نیاز. یک فیلد ماسک برای محدود کردن اینکه کدام فیلد برای هر فرد بازگردانده می شود. چندین فیلد را می توان با جدا کردن آنها با کاما مشخص کرد. مقادیر معتبر عبارتند از:

  • آدرس ها
  • محدوده سنی
  • بیوگرافی ها
  • تولدها
  • calendarUrls
  • کلاینت دیتا
  • جلدعکس ها
  • آدرس های ایمیل
  • رویدادها
  • شناسه های خارجی
  • جنسیت ها
  • imClients
  • منافع
  • مناطق
  • مکان ها
  • عضویت ها
  • ابرداده
  • کلمات کلیدی اشتباه
  • نام ها
  • نام مستعار
  • مشاغل
  • سازمان ها
  • شماره تلفن
  • عکس ها
  • روابط
  • آدرس های sip
  • مهارت ها
  • آدرس های اینترنتی
  • userDefined
sources[]

enum ( ReadSourceType )

اختیاری. ماسکی از نوع منبع برای بازگشت. در صورت تنظیم نشدن، پیش‌فرض READ_SOURCE_TYPE_CONTACT و READ_SOURCE_TYPE_PROFILE است.

درخواست بدن

بدنه درخواست باید خالی باشد.

بدن پاسخگو

پاسخ به درخواست دریافت لیستی از افراد بر اساس نام منبع.

در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:

نمایندگی JSON
{
  "responses": [
    {
      object (PersonResponse)
    }
  ]
}
فیلدها
responses[]

object ( PersonResponse )

پاسخ برای هر نام منبع درخواستی.

محدوده مجوز

برای دسترسی به داده های عمومی نیازی به مجوز نیست. برای داده های خصوصی، یکی از حوزه های OAuth زیر مورد نیاز است:

  • https://www.googleapis.com/auth/contacts
  • https://www.googleapis.com/auth/contacts.readonly
  • https://www.googleapis.com/auth/contacts.other.readonly
  • https://www.googleapis.com/auth/directory.readonly
  • https://www.googleapis.com/auth/profile.agerange.read
  • https://www.googleapis.com/auth/profile.emails.read
  • https://www.googleapis.com/auth/profile.language.read
  • https://www.googleapis.com/auth/user.addresses.read
  • https://www.googleapis.com/auth/user.birthday.read
  • https://www.googleapis.com/auth/user.emails.read
  • https://www.googleapis.com/auth/user.gender.read
  • https://www.googleapis.com/auth/user.organization.read
  • https://www.googleapis.com/auth/user.phonenumbers.read
  • https://www.googleapis.com/auth/userinfo.email
  • https://www.googleapis.com/auth/userinfo.profile
  • https://www.googleapis.com/auth/profile.language.read

بر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.